Partner Visa

Individuals with permanent Australian visa and is married can apply for Partner Visa for their spouse. Interdependent or same sex partners are also eligible for Partner Visa. Partner is considered as sponsor of his or her spouse and the sponsorship must be at-least two years. After this time period if the relationship is still continuing, you can apply for permanent residence. Application should include legal document to support marriage, police clearance certificate and medical examination certificate. You can also apply for Partner Visa from outside Australia but you need to proof that you have Australian Citizenship or you are a Permanent Residence of Australia. New Zealand citizens can also apply for Partner Visa to Australia.

The processing take some time but can vary from individual to individual according to their application and requirements. Applicant should refrain from doing anything like resigning their job, selling property during the visa processing. Partner Visa applications are issued on the basis of the genuinity of the relationship. And the council we do background verification on how long and committed is the relationship with the sponsor. Visa Subclasses

Temporary Partner Visa (Sub Class 820)

This visa lets the partner or spouse of an Australian citizen or permanent resident to live in Australia temporarily. This visa is the first step that allows getting the permanent partner visa sub class (801). Initially the temporary visa is granted while applying for partner visa towards Australia. Permanent Partner Visa (SubClass 801)

This visa lets the partner or spouse of an Australian citizen or permanent resident to live in Australia permanently. This visa is for people who hold a temporary visa (Sub Class 820). The visa subclass 801 visa is a permanent partner visa. Basically, it is meant for couples in which one partner is a resident of Australia, and they would like to have their non-Australian partner be able to immigrate and join them.

Overseas Partner Visa (Outside Australia)

Overseas Partner allows those individuals to live in Australia who are a spouse or de facto partner of an either Australian citizen, permanent resident or eligible New Zealand citizen. There are two types of Overseas Partner Visa. One is Sub Class 309 and is called Provisional Visa. Second is Sub Class 100 and is called Migrant visa.
